Carl Junction and Parsons have remarkably similar climates.

The year at a glance

Averages from 30 years of climate history, 1991-2020

Annual weather statistics for Carl Junction, MO and Parsons, KS
Carl JunctionMetricParsons
221 daysSunny daysclear or partly cloudy skies227 days
43 inPrecipitationper year43 in
110 daysWet daysrain or snow per year103 days
8 inSnowfallper year7 in
52 daysHot daysabove 90 °F47 days
87 daysFreezing nightsat or below 32 °F103 days
68%Humidityaverage relative66%
58 °FAverage temperatureyear round57 °F

About this data

Every figure on this page is a 30 year average computed from daily climate history for 1991-2020, using each city's own coordinates. Wet days count days with measurable precipitation, calibrated against the wet day counts in NOAA's published climate normals. Sunny days count clear plus partly cloudy days, defined as average cloud cover of 63 percent or less and calibrated against NOAA's published sky cover tables. Snowfall figures are model estimates anchored to NOAA station measurements near each city.
